TURN-208: Gatevale turnstile counters at the Merrow Field pilot double-count when a rotation reverses mid-cycle. Attendance totals drift roughly 2% high per event. The debounce window fix is implemented, reviewed by Ilsa, and soak-tested across two simulated match days without drift. Ready for your cut; the candidate build is identified below.

trace token, tagag-tafog: htk6_5ed18c

**Q: How do I publish a new version of the Brindlewood component library?**

A: As a contractor, you have publish rights but not version-bump rights — that distinction trips people up. Open a release request in the Brindlewood console, pick semver level, and wait for a maintainer's approval. If the console reports your signing session as expired, use the recovery dialog and enter the passphrase shown below.

vault phrase of tajop-haduf = holath-brivan-wenax

Changelog — ProctorLane Queue v2.8.1. Rotated the signing key for exam-session payloads after the scheduled 90-day window. Old key revoked at 06:00 UTC; queued sessions signed before cutover remain valid until drained. Support: candidates on stale clients may see "signature mismatch" — advise a restart, no re-enrollment needed. No schema changes. The new active signing key for verification tooling is as follows.

signing key of bagap-yawep = bky13_TbfT6ZMUoGJo2

**Action Item 4 (owner: relevance team):** Document all search ranking weight changes from the Marrowgate incident, including the rationale for reducing the recency boost and the evaluation results that justified it. New team members should read this before touching any tuning parameters, as undocumented changes were a contributing factor. The consolidated tuning notes and change log are maintained on the following internal page.

wiki page, tagef-bajog: https://grafana.nelvrocorp.corp/projects/pages/display/fa238a928afe